| Career Role |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Environmental Policy Analyst | Analyzing policies, assessing environmental impact, recommending sustainable solutions. |
| Sustainability Consultant | Advising organizations on sustainable practices, reducing environmental footprint. |
| Corporate Social Responsibility Manager | Developing CSR strategies, ensuring ethical business practices. |
| Environmental Economist | Evaluating economic impact of environmental policies, conducting cost-benefit analysis. |
| Climate Change Analyst | Researching climate trends, developing mitigation strategies. |
| Ethical Investment Advisor | Guiding clients on environmentally responsible investments. |
| Environmental Educator | Teaching and raising awareness about environmental ethics and economics. |
